Transaction 79891c812712ef7c43bc753def1ed79a9a6750d5026fda4e323365796838e70b
1 Input
1 Output
-
79891c812712ef7c43bc753def1ed79a9a6750d5026fda4e323365796838e70b:0
- value
- 20652
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ab6b2d37ecb5c9759d94655a7fffe0fc51963a6271df0e9a162c3ccd76623542
- address
- bc1p4d4j6dlvkhyht8v5v4d8lllql3gevwnzw80saxsk9s7v6anzx4pquujt8e